A quote from the book Missing May by Cynthia Rylant that I thought was really sweet and sad. It's a great book, you should read it. This is what you need to know:
The storyteller- Summer, an orphan living with her uncle
May- Summer's deceased aunt
Ob- Summer's uncle
Chapter 1
A Quote
May always said we were angels before we were ever people. She said when we were finished being people we'd go back to being angels. And we'd never feel pain again.
But what is it that makes a person want to stay here on this earth anyway, and go on suffering the most awful pain just for the sake of getting to stay?
I used to think it was because people fear death. But now I think it is because people can't bear saying good-bye.
May was lucky. When she had to say her good-bye to Ob, she had to hurt over it only once. And then she was an angel and it didn't hurt her anymore.
But Ob. Ob hurt and he kept on hurting. Living in a trailer full of May's empty spaces. Walking through May's dying garden. Sleeping in a bed that still left room for her.
He hurt so much. But even after his most terrible hours, he decided to stay here on this earth. Right out of the blue, he wanted to live again. And I'd like to think maybe he wanted to live because of me. Because he couldn't bear the thought of saying good-bye to me.
